What It Is

The Holdly GX26422 is an aftermarket replacement deck belt for select John Deere ZTrak zero-turn mowers. It drives the blades on 54-inch decks (Z325E, Z375R, Z330M, Z330R) and 48-inch decks (Z355E, Z355R, Z365R) — a direct replacement for OEM part GX26422.

Fitment & Compatibility

Before buying, verify your mower’s deck size (54” or 48”) and model number (e.g., Z325E, not just “Z325”). This belt is 1/2 inch wide x 146 inches long — measure your old belt or check your owner’s manual for the OEM GX26422 part number. It’s an aftermarket belt, so it will fit those specific John Deere ZTrak models but may differ slightly from OEM in material or stiffness. Double-check your deck’s belt routing diagram — routing errors cause premature wear or belt slip.

Key Things to Know

  • Quality vs. OEM: Holdly belts are typically Kevlar-reinforced and cost 30–50% less than John Deere genuine parts, but some users report slightly shorter lifespan (especially in heavy grass or debris).
  • Installation difficulty: Easy to moderate — you’ll need a wrench to release the idler pulley tension. No special tools required, but a belt routing diagram (online or in manual) is essential.
  • Common gotcha: The belt may feel tight or slightly stiff when new. Run the mower for 5 minutes at low throttle to seat it; recheck tension after the first use.
  • Check pulleys: Inspect all deck pulleys for wear, rust, or wobble before installing — a bad pulley will eat any belt fast.
